 Life is short...no matter how long you live, it just is not enough time to do everything, learn everything, and see everything. Now that I am turning sixty-four, I look back and wish I had done so many things differently. Not really any regrets, just thoughts on how I could have avoided some sadness and made more happiness. I imagine many people my age feel the same. I guess that is why "live and learn" is a cliché.  Well, here I am, nearly sixty-four and working on what I suppose will be my last home. I bought the old 1940s house about two years ago, but with COVID and other situations, I only started remodeling in September of 2022.  I decided to name the house "The Crow's Nest" because I am much like a crow, twinkling, shiny objects catch my eye and I gather them up and store them in my home.
